>>Wanted:  DOS software to run Archive VP 60e tape backup drive (1/4" tape) on
>>         386 with Adaptec SCSI controller (Ad1542).
>>I don't have any documentation or software for the above drive.  It works
>>fine under Unix with tar.

>I think what you want is SYTOS (SYtron Tape Operating System).
>I am fairly sure they support the Adaptec 1542 and the Archive drives.
>I don't have Sytron's address or phone number handy however. Sorry.

The correct package to make it work under DOS is the ASW-1410 ASPI SCSI
Manager along with the ASW-210 (SyTos) or ASW-310 (SyTos Plus).  If you 
bought the SCSI Master Kit you already have the ASW-1410, but if you didn't
you will need it as well.
